The town of Loma Santo Tomás is located in the Municipality of San Andrés Teotilálpam (in the State of Oaxaca). There are 4 inhabitants. Of all the towns in the municipality, it occupies the number #19 in terms of number of inhabitants. Loma Santo Tomás is at 365 meters of altitude.

The town of Loma Santo Tomás is located at 16.4 kilometers from San Andrés Teotilálpam, which is the most populated locality in the municipality, in the East direction. If you browse our webpage, you will also find a map with the location of Loma Santo Tomás.
